What does Gordian mean and where does it come from?
Gordian derives from the name Gordius, a historical figure associated with Phrygia in ancient Anatolia.
Cultural significance
The name is often associated with the Gordian Knot, a symbol of complex problems and their solutions.

Famous people named Gordian
GI
Gordian III
Roman Emperor from 238 to 244 AD, known for his youth and military campaigns.
